Vivaro Video, also known as TVTEL, a privately owned company headquartered in Chile, was founded in 2015 and operates with approximately 60 employees. The company addresses needs in the Chilean and international market, with its operations beginning by personalizing live broadcasts for three TV channels during the 2018 Russia Confederations Cup. It now produces events across all countries in the Southern Cone, including Copa Libertadores, Sudamericana, Qatar 2020 Qualifiers, and local tournaments. The company offers capabilities in live programming, transmissions, and remote virtual reality, utilizing assets such as Omnicam aerial cameras, Live U equipment, mobile units, satellite DSNG, and various other camera types.
